[英]Can resque and resque-scheduler jobs run in parallel?
如何使resque和resque-scheduler作業並行工作,
這樣我可以同時雇兩個工人
COUNT=2 QUEUE=* rake resque:workers
但是當2個resque作業正在工作時,resque-scheduler作業正在排隊中,
我需要resque-scheduler作業與resque作業並行運行
Resque允許您使用不同的工作隊列,並設置優先級列表,列出工作人員從中進行工作的隊列。
例如,如果您有一個優先級更高的名為“ batch_jobs”的隊列和一個名為“預定”工作的隊列,則可以使用以下命令運行兩個工作程序:
COUNT=2 QUEUE=scheduled,batch_jobs rake resque:workers
當從resque-scheduler計划作業時,將其放入“預定”隊列中將使它們在“ batch_jobs”隊列中的作業之前執行。
每個工作人員將連續掃描QUEUES列表,以嘗試找到要處理的工作。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.